The host restaurant of the al-Abbas's (p) Holy Shrine offers 4,000 meals to the security forces.

The Host Restaurant of the al-Abbas's (p) Holy Shrine has provided the security forces charged with maintaining security and preventive curfew measures, taken to limit the spread of the Corona epidemic in the Karbala Governorate, with 4,000 food meals in appreciation of their efforts during this period.
The initiative, as explained by the official of the host restaurant department, Hajj Adel Al-Hamami: "It came in conjunction with the auspicious birth anniversary of the awaited Imam al-Mahdi (may Allah hasten his holy reappearance), and based on the directives of the General Secretariat of the al-Abbas's (p) Holy Shrine, which is part of a package of initiatives that it adopted during this period, in appreciation of the efforts made and the great heroic work presented by the classes and formations of the Ministry of Interior and Defense, in sacrificing themselves within the first blocking lines in order to save the lives of citizens, and to preserve their health and safety from the deadly Corona epidemic."
He added: "(4000) food meals have been prepared in addition to fruits and sweets, and they have been distributed in the field to all the security departments of the province, from fixed and mobile controls up to their external entrances. And we will have other campaigns in the coming days, God willing."
For his part, Major General Ahmad Ali Zwaini, Commander of the Police of Karbala, expressed his great thanks and sincere gratitude to the supreme religious authority, for the unparalleled support that it showed to all the Iraqi people without exception and in all circumstances and times, extending his thanks and appreciation to The holy shrines of Imam al-Hussayn and of al-Abbas and their staffs, for their supportive, honorable and distinguished role during the Corona crisis.
